Boston Walking Tour: Seafood and History

Embark on a historic culinary walking tour in Boston and discover the city’s iconic sites while indulging in delicious seafood dishes. From lobster rolls to clam chowder, experience the best of Boston’s renowned seafood fare.

Additional Information

Experience the culinary and historical delights of Boston on this walking tour. Join a local guide as they lead you through some of the city’s most iconic and historic sites, such as Independence Wharf, Boston Harbour, Quincy Market, Faneuil Hall, and the Rose Kennedy Greenway.
